1897
birth Gloucester, Gloucestershire United Kingdom Source:7671838 Source:8683210 14th July 1897
1914
enlistment Source:7671838 5th October 1914
1914
service Royal Navy 17949 Royal Marine Light Infantry: Portsmouth Division Source:7671838 5th October 1914
service Royal Navy Private PO/17949 Royal Marine Light Infantry - HMS Hampshire Source:8683210
1916
death Died when HMS 'Hampshire' sank Source:8683208 5th June 1916
burial Portsmouth Naval Memorial CWGC Cemetery/Memorial Hampshire United Kingdom Source:8683208
